The Texas Veterans Association composed solely of revolutionary veterans living in Texas was active from 1873 through 1901 and played a key role in convincing the legislature to create a monument to honor the San Jacinto veterans in the late 19th century the Texas Legislature purchased the San Jacinto battlesite which is now home to the San Jacinto Monument the tallest stone column monument in the world in the early 20th century the Texas Legislature purchased the Alamo Mission now an official state shrine in front of the church in the center of Alamo Plaza stands a cenotaph designed by Pompeo Coppini which commemorates the defenders who died during the battle. The Harris County Jail Complex of the Harris County Sheriff's Office (HCSO) is the largest in Texas and one of the largest in the nation in July 2012 the facility held 9,113 prisoners to handle overcrowding in the facility the county had to ship inmates to other counties and some are housed out of the state; . Many free blacks were able to become businessmen and leaders Through the young Republican Party blacks rapidly gained political power Indeed blacks comprised 90% of the Texas Republican Party during the 1880s.
